Skip to content

Commit 370c7f8

Browse files
committed
Merge pull request reworkcss#20 from alexeyten/master
Add @namespace support
2 parents 67ddc83 + ef85829 commit 370c7f8

File tree

3 files changed

+17
-0
lines changed

3 files changed

+17
-0
lines changed

lib/compress.js

Lines changed: 8 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-80,6 +80,14 @@ Compiler.prototype.charset = function(node){
8080
return '@charset ' + node.charset + ';';
8181
};
8282

83+
/**
84+
* Visit namespace node.
85+
*/
86+
87+
Compiler.prototype.namespace = function(node){
88+
return '@namespace ' + node.namespace + ';';
89+
};
90+
8391
/**
8492
* Visit supports node.
8593
*/

lib/identity.js

Lines changed: 8 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-93,6 +93,14 @@ Compiler.prototype.charset = function(node){
9393
return '@charset ' + node.charset + ';\n';
9494
};
9595

96+
/**
97+
* Visit namespace node.
98+
*/
99+
100+
Compiler.prototype.namespace = function(node){
101+
return '@namespace ' + node.namespace + ';\n';
102+
};
103+
96104
/**
97105
* Visit supports node.
98106
*/

test/cases/at_namespace.css

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1 @@
1+
@namespace svg "http://www.w3.org/2000/svg";

0 commit comments

Comments
 (0)